I am currently looking at parts for my first computer build. At first I wanted the EVGA GeForce GTX 770 that's about $350. But now that I have picked the other parts, I am a little bit above budget. Does anyone have any suggestions on a cheaper GPU that still delivers on the same level as the 770?

Okay here it goes, unless you will get an amazing monitor along with this 770 (to play at anything over 1080p) then certain wait and get this card. If you won't be doing anything over 1080p the GTX 760 does an amazing job for the majority of the games at 60+ frames (see this link to compare them side by side ( http://anandtech.com/bench/product/1038?vs=1037 )

here is an overclocked version for $260 (with rebate) rest of that cash you can stuff in your pocket.

http://www.microcenter.com/product/416464/N760_TF_2GD5-...

Remember, it would be a total waste of cash you purchase the best GPU out there and don't use it at the best resolutions (as it should be done).
